snmp-server traps link-status 
Description 
The  snmp-server traps link-status command is used to enable SNMP link 
status trap for the specified port. To disable the sending of SNMP link status trap, 
please use no snmp-server traps link-status command.  
Syntax 
snmp-server traps link-status 
no snmp-server traps link-status 
Command Mode 
Interface Configuration Mode (interface fastEthernet / interface range 
fastEthernet / interface gigabitEthernet / interface range gigabitEthernet/ 
interface ten-gigabitEthernet / interface range ten-gigabitEthernet) 
Example 
Enable SNMP link status trap for port 1/0/3: 
T3700G-28TQ(config)# interface gigabitEthernet 1/0/3 
TL- SG3424P(config-if)# snmp-server traps link-status 
snmp-server traps 
Description 
The snmp-server traps command is used to enable SNMP extended traps. To 
disable the sending of SNMP extended traps, please use no snmp-server 
traps command. 
Syntax 
snmp-server traps { bandwidth-control | cpu | flash | ipaddr-change | lldp | 
loopback-detection | storm-control | spanning-tree | memory } 
no snmp-server traps { bandwidth-control | cpu | flash | ipaddr-change | lldp | 
loopback-detection | storm-control | spanning-tree | memory } 
Parameter 
bandwidth-control —— Enable bandwidth-control trap. It is sent when the rate 
limit function is enabled and the bandwidth exceeds the predefined value. 
cpu —— Allow CPU-related trap. It is sent when CPU usage exceeds the 
predefined threshold. By default, the CPU usage threshold of the switch is 80%.
